As a Senior Tax Accountant (salary range $80,000-$90,000, minimum of 2+ years of public tax accounting experience), you will:
- Prepare personal, trust, estate and business tax returns, including the most complex
- Act as a resource for tax staff
- Prepare tax estimates and becomes involved in planning for less complex clients
- Analyze IRS notices and draft responses
- Contribute to the client service team by producing quality work with quick turnaround and attentive service
- Engage in firm committees by contributing ideas and feedback to support the firm's strategic objectives. Participate actively in firm initiatives.
- Establish good working relationships with all Shareholders and staff members

We love to throw in a good perk, or two, or three, or more because we are invested in YOU! We offer EXCELLENT benefits that are an integral part of the total competitive compensation package.
- 40-hour work week except for busy season – max of 50 hours (Feb-Apr)
- 5 weeks compensated time off (CTO) annually; paid holidays
- Insurance (Medical, dental, vision and group term life)
- 401(k) Plan, with Safe Harbor match
- Flexible Spending Account;
Health Savings Account - Continuing professional education and professional licensing paid for by the firm
- Business expense and mileage reimbursement
- Relocation expenses are negotiable
A bachelor’s or master’s degree in accounting or other closely related field. 2+ years of public tax accounting.
- CPA license (preferred, but not required)
- Strong team mindset, adaptability skills and ability to identify and make efficiency improvements
- Ability to communicate clearly in writing and verbally
- Ability to multitask with multiple projects
- Highly motivated, driven and takes initiative
- Willing to learn, open to feedback and recognize contributions from others
- Ability to use good judgement and intuition amongst everyday interactions with staff and clients.
- Ability to establish and maintain effective working relationships with co-workers and clients
- Demonstrate critical and analytical thinking skills
- Meet deadlines by setting priorities with work projects
- Proficiency using tax software, trial balance, Excel, Word and Outlook (CCH products a plus)
